Executive Summary and Global Market Analysis
Automotive composites, advanced lightweight materials created from a strategic combination of fibers and resins, are becoming increasingly vital in vehicle manufacturing. Their main benefits include reducing vehicle mass, which directly leads to improved fuel efficiency, and simultaneously enhancing overall vehicle performance. These composites are essential for complying with strict environmental regulations and are central to the automotive industry's ongoing commitment to sustainability. The global automotive composites market is experiencing significant growth, primarily driven by the escalating demand for lightweight materials in the automotive sector. This demand is directly linked to the need to boost fuel efficiency and adhere to increasingly rigorous environmental standards. Governments worldwide are implementing more demanding emission standards and fuel efficiency requirements. By effectively reducing vehicle weight, automotive composites directly contribute to superior fuel economy and diminished CO2 emissions, enabling manufacturers to meet these critical regulatory mandates.
Automotive Composites Market Segmentation Analysis
By Fiber Type
By fiber type, the automotive composites market is segmented into glass fiber composites, carbon fiber composites, and other categories. The glass fiber composites segment attained the largest market share in 2024, highlighting its widespread adoption and acceptance.
By Resin Type
With respect to resin type, the automotive composites market is clearly differentiated into thermoset resins (including polyester, epoxy, vinyl ester, polyurethane, and others) and thermoplastics (such as polyethylene, polypropylene, polycarbonate, polymethyl methacrylate, and others). The thermoset resins segment secured the largest market share in 2024, reflecting its increasing application in various components.
By Technology
In terms of technology, the automotive composites market is categorized into pultrusion, injection molding, compression molding, and other manufacturing processes. The injection molding segment held the largest market share in 2024, demonstrating its efficiency and adaptability in manufacturing processes.

Automotive Composites Market Drivers and Opportunities
The persistent rise in fuel prices and growing environmental consciousness regarding conventional gasoline vehicles have undeniably accelerated the global movement towards alternative fuel vehicles. Consumers are increasingly showing a strong inclination towards acquiring battery-powered or hybrid automobiles, a powerful trend projected to significantly stimulate the demand for electric vehicles (EVs). According to the International Energy Agency's annual Global Electric Vehicle Outlook, over 10 million electric cars were sold worldwide in 2022, with a projected remarkable increase of 35% in 2023, reaching 14 million units. As the automotive industry undergoes a profound and sweeping transformative shift towards EVs, the strategic role of composites has become even more critically important. Governments are also proactively providing attractive laws and incentives to vigorously promote EV sales.
Automotive Composites Market Size and Share Analysis
Based on fiber type, the market comprises glass fiber composites, carbon fiber composites, and other materials. The glass fiber composites segment commanded the largest automotive composites market share in 2024. Glass fiber composites maintain a dominant position in the automotive composites market primarily due to their advantageous blend of performance, cost-effectiveness, and broad applicability. Glass fibers are extensively employed in a diverse range of automotive applications due to their exceptional strength-to-weight ratio, high durability, and inherent resistance to challenging environmental factors such as moisture and various chemicals.
In terms of application, the market is distinctly segmented into structural assembly, powertrain components, and exteriors. The exteriors segment held the largest automotive composites market share in 2024. The exterior segment of the automotive composites market is a dynamic and innovative area where manufacturers consistently strive to enhance vehicle aesthetics, comfort, safety, and overall performance.
